The climate crisis poses a number of legal challenges. It calls for a social and economic transformation necessitating a legal transformation, in addition to which societal reactions to transformation measures already taken raise legal problems, and the consequences of the climate crises that have already occurred need to be addressed. The authors who contribute to this volume discuss these various legal challenges.
